#4a0f64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a0f64 is composed of 29% red, 5.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 85%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 281.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 22.5%. #4a0f64 color hex could be obtained by blending #941ec8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#4a0f64 color description : Very dark violet.
#4a0f64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a0f64 has RGB values of R:74, G:15,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 4853604.

Shades and Tints of #4a0f64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020f is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.
